Concrete porch repair services involve restoring and improving the surface of a porch made from concrete. Over time, exposure to weather, foot traffic, and natural settling can cause cracks, chips, and uneven areas that compromise both the appearance and safety of the porch. Local contractors specializing in concrete repair can assess the condition of a porch, identify underlying issues, and perform necessary fixes such as filling cracks, patching damaged sections, and leveling uneven surfaces. This process helps maintain the porch’s structural integrity and enhances curb appeal, making it safer and more attractive for everyday use.

Many common problems lead homeowners to seek concrete porch repair services. Cracks are often caused by temperature fluctuations, moisture infiltration, or ground movement, and if left untreated, they can expand and weaken the overall structure. Surface deterioration, such as spalling or flaking, can also occur due to freeze-thaw cycles or poor initial installation. In addition, uneven or sunken areas may develop over time, creating tripping hazards and an unkempt appearance.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services can prevent further damage and extend the life of the porch.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Porch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or concrete porch repairs typically cost between $250 and $600. These jobs often involve patching cracks or small surface fixes and are common among local contractors for routine maintenance.

Surface Resurfacing - Resurfacing a concrete porch gener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000, depending on the size and condition. Many projects fall within this middle range, with fewer reaching the higher end for extensive work.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ire concrete porch can cost between $4,000 and $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into higher tiers, but most replacements stay within this range based on size and design.

Custom Features - Adding custom finishes or decorative elements can vary widely, with typical costs from $2,000 to $5,000. These projects are less common but can significantly impact overall expenses depending on complexity and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ete porch repairs do local contractors handle? Local contractors can address issues such as cracks, spalling, uneven surfaces, and damaged edges to restore the integrity and appearance of a concrete porch.

How can I tell if my concrete porch needs repair? Signs like visible cracks, sinking or settling, surface scaling, or water pooling can indicate that a concrete porch requires professional repair services.

Are there different repair methods for concrete porches? Yes, options include crack filling, patching, resurfacing, and leveling, depending on the extent and type of damage present.
